Subject: DR drill — digest scheduler notes for weekly sync

Team,

During Thursday's disaster-recovery drill at the Havencrest site, we failed over the Plumeline batch email digest scheduler. Digests queued during the cutover were deferred, not dropped, and replayed within nine minutes. One caveat: the hourly digest window shifted by one cycle, which we'll discuss at sync. To unlock the drill vault snapshot, use the passphrase below.

vault phrase of kawep-tahog = ulaix-briath

Leadership Review Briefing — Gross Margin

Gross margin at Fennick Coatings slipped to 31.2% this quarter, down 180 basis points, driven by resin input costs and discounting in the Calloway account. Pricing actions recover roughly half by Q4. The finance team should hold current forecasts pending the decision outlined in the confidential note below.

board note of kageg-bahof: The renewal with Holwynax Holdings closes at $2 million a year, 5 percent below the last contract. Project Ulaath slips by two quarters because of the supplier delay.

### Step 7 — Cutover cron jobs to Spindleflow

Disable legacy crontab on both app hosts. Import job definitions into Spindleflow via the migration script; verify all twelve show as registered. Do not enable triggers yet. Update spindleflow.env: set the scheduler host, the retry ceiling to 3, and the dead-letter queue name. The engine refuses to start without its API credential, which must appear on the line directly after the queue name. Then enable triggers, one job at a time.

vault entry, yahif-yajep: COURIER_KEY29=b802bdf8034096b65a51c6ba5abe2